Advantages of Smart Infotainment for Hybrid and Electric Cars
As the automotive industry evolves, hybrid and electric vehicles (EVs) are becoming increasingly popular. One key feature that enhances the driving experience of these modern vehicles is smart infotainment systems. These systems not only provide entertainment but also streamline vehicle operations and improve overall user engagement. Here are the primary advantages of smart infotainment systems in hybrid and electric cars.
1. Enhanced Connectivity
Smart infotainment systems allow seamless integration with smartphones and other devices. This connectivity offers drivers access to navigation, music streaming, and hands-free calling, fostering a safer, more enjoyable driving experience. With features like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, users can easily utilize their favorite apps while on the road.
2. Real-Time Information
In hybrid and electric cars, smart infotainment systems provide real-time data on battery status, charging station locations, and energy consumption. This information is crucial for drivers to manage their vehicle's range effectively, ensuring they can plan trips without the anxiety of running out of power.

5. Over-the-Air Updates
With smart infotainment in hybrid and electric vehicles, software updates can be delivered over the air, eliminating the need for dealership visits. This means that systems can continuously improve, adding new features and enhancing existing functionalities without any hassle for the user.
6. Optimized Energy Management
Smart infotainment systems can optimize energy management by providing insights into driving habits and suggesting more efficient routes. These features can help drivers maximize their vehicle's range, making electric and hybrid cars even more economical and environmentally friendly.
